Savor the decadence of these grain-free and gluten-free Paleo Triple Chocolate Donuts. These moist, chocolatey treats are made with almond and coconut flour, making them ideal for sating your sweet tooth.
Ingredients: 1 cup almond flour. 1/4 cup coconut flour. 1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der. 1/4 cup coconut sugar. 1/4 cup dark chocolate chips Paleo-friendly. 1/4 cup coconut oil melted. 3 large eggs. 1 tsp vanilla extract. 1/2 tsp baking soda. Pinch of salt. 1/4 cup dairy-free chocolate chips for topping.
Instructions: Preheat your oven to 350F 175C and grease a donut pan. In a large mixing bowl, combine almond flour, coconut flour, cocoa powder, coconut sugar, dark chocolate chips, baking soda, and a pinch of salt. In a separate bowl, whisk together the melted coconut oil, eggs, and vanilla extract.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until well combined. Spoon the batter into the prepared donut pan, filling each cavity about 3/4 full. Bake in the preheated oven for 15-18 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into a donut comes out clean. Remove the donuts from the oven and let them cool in the pan for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. Melt the dairy-free chocolate chips in the microwave or using a double boiler, and drizzle it over the cooled donuts. Allow the chocolate drizzle to set before serving. Enjoy your Paleo Triple Chocolate Donuts!
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 18 minutes
